Performance Improvement Projects. A. The Contractor shall conduct a minimum of two Performance Improvement Projects (PIPs) per year, including any PIPs required by DHCS or CMS. DHCS may require additional PIPs. One PIP shall focus on a clinical area and one on a non-clinical area. (42 C.F.R. § 438.330(b)(1) and (d)(1).) Each PIP shall: 1) Be designed to achieve significant improvement, sustained over time, in health outcomes and beneficiary satisfaction; 2) Include measurement of performance using objective quality indicators; 3) Include implementation of interventions to achieve improvement in the access to and quality of care; 4) Include an evaluation of the effectiveness of the interventions based on the performance measures collected as part of the PIP; and, 5) Include planning and initiation of activities for increasing or sustaining improvement. (42 C.F.R. § 438.330(d)(2).) B. The Contractor shall report the status and results of each performance improvement project to the Department as requested, but not less than once per year. (42 C.F.R. § 438.330(d)(3).)
